NEWS UPDATE: An interesting story caught our eye in the latest round-up from @ThePlanner_RTPI: Bolton Metropolitan Borough Council will have to pay a developer's legal bill of nearly £468,000 after it refused a 1,036-home scheme against officer advice.
theplanner.co.uk
Bolton Metropolitan Borough Council will pay a developer's legal bill of nearly £468,000 after refusing a 1,036-home scheme against officer advice.

QUARTERLY UPDATE: New figures from the government show a fall in planning permissions granted in England for the first three months of this year - down 11% from the same quarter a year earlier. #planning #planningnews.
